uigesturerecognizer相关内容

UIDatePicker上的UITapGestureRecognizer在iOS 15中不起作用

我有一行供用户选择日期,我使用UIDatePicker来完成此操作。当用户点击它时,我希望它更改行上的一些文本,以及打开日期选择器。这之前在我的UIDatePicker上的UITapGestureRecognizer可以很好地工作,可以激活一些代码,但有东西破坏了它,现在我的UITapGestureRecognizer根本无法识别! 我认为可能是iOS 15改变了一些东西,但看了看文档,我真 ..

未调用手势识别器

我已经设置了一个手势识别器,用于当用户在文本字段外点击时取消键盘。DismissKeyboard未调用函数。 我设置观察者是错误的还是这是一个不同的问题?此外,这是正在点击的表视图。 代码摘录 class CommentsViewController: UIViewController, UITableViewDelegate, UITableViewDataSource { ..
发布时间:2022-04-16 14:00:18 移动开发

在Tableview自定义单元格中的图像上长按手势

我需要帮助。今天,我正在处理表视图自定义单元格,其中单元格包含UIImageView。在ImageView上,我想实现Long手势。我实现了下面给出的代码。但我在我的代码中做了一些错误的事情。在这种情况下,长按一次视图就会调整大小,但我希望在几秒钟后它可以被删除,并在表格视图单元格中返回 有人能推荐我吗? 更新: 代码如下! - (void)celllongpressed:(UI ..

透明视图上的UITapGestureRecognizer

我有一个树,其中最高级别的视图是透明的,并且包含图像或标签(具有透明背景)。 将UITapGestureRecognizer附加到此视图时,我只收到有关包含图像的视图的通知。 另外,如果我将该视图留空,则只有在背景颜色与[UIColor clearColor]不同时才会收到事件。 我进行了转储,整个视图树的UserInteractionEnable=yes。 如何使UITapG ..
发布时间:2022-04-16 13:55:13 移动开发

为什么使用UIPanGestureRecognizer移动对象时会有延迟?

我使用UIPanGestureRecognizer移动UIView对象-我在屏幕上拖动手指的程度,即我在同一方向上移动视图的程度(仅在X向左或向右移动,Y方向不变)。它工作正常,但延迟。 下面是处理UIPanGestureRecognizer事件的方法: -(void)movePages:(UIPanGestureRecognizer *)sender { if (switch ..

如何响应开始在视图之外触摸并在iOS中拖动进入的触摸事件

我想在视图上响应这种触摸事件:开始在视图外触摸并拖动进入.我曾尝试使用 iOS UIControlEvent,例如 UIControlEventTouchDragEnter、UIControlEventTouchDragInside 和 UIGesture,但我发现无法直接执行此操作.最后,我用自己的方式实现它:创建一个自定义的 UIView 子类并覆盖方法 (UIView *)hitTest:( ..
发布时间:2022-01-23 11:03:01 移动开发

检测UIGestureRecognizer何时上下左右Cocos2d

我有一个 CCSprite,我想用手势四处移动.问题是我对 Cocos2D 完全陌生.我希望我的精灵在手势向上时执行一个动作,在手势向下时执行另一个动作,在手势正确时执行另一个动作,向左执行相同操作.有人可以指出我正确的方向吗? 谢谢! 解决方案 显然每个 UISwipeGestureRecognizer 只能检测到给定方向的滑动.即使方向标志可以被或在一起,UISwipeGestu ..
发布时间:2022-01-21 17:02:35 移动开发

iOS/Swift UIImageView (.jpg) 无法识别我的点击手势?

我有一个简单的代码块,可以在我的图像被点击时播放声音.但是,当我点击我的图像时,甚至无法识别点击. 我相信这是真的,因为当点击图像时,handleTap 函数中的 println 不会打印任何内容. 谁能告诉我问题出在哪里? var coinSound = NSURL(fileURLWithPath: NSBundle.mainBundle().pathForResource("wa ..
发布时间:2022-01-20 16:05:04 移动开发

UIImageView 上的 UIGestureRecognizer

我有一个 UIImageView,我希望它能够调整大小和旋转等. UIGestureRecognizer可以添加到UIImageView吗? 我想在运行时创建的 UIImageView 中添加旋转和捏合识别器. 如何添加这些识别器? 解决方案 检查 UIImageView 上的 userInteractionEnabled 是否为 YES.然后你可以添加一个手势识别器. ..
发布时间:2022-01-20 15:22:10 移动开发

在 UIWebview 中检测滑动手势

我是 iPhone 开发者的新手, 我制作了epub阅读器并在我的webview中加载了epub的每一页 我想要的是,当用户第二次执行 右滑动手势 然后我想导航到新页面,当用户执行 右滑动手势时我不想做任何事情 第一次. UISwipeGestureRecognizer *swipeRight 有没有类似的方法, if(swipeRight.touch.count > 2 ..
发布时间:2022-01-19 22:19:59 移动开发